Abstract:
In this paper, the influencing factors of non-melt-through weld quality target mark of laser scanning welding technology are studied. The authors first study the detectability of the existing online monitoring system to confirm the effectiveness of the monitoring system for checking the welding characteristics. According to the DOE experimental design, the correlation of welding process and working conditions on porosity and penetration was explored. Under the premise of ensuring the formation of the weld, the formation mechanism of pores is analyzed,and the suppression mechanism of pores by various suppression technologies is explained. Determine the technical approach and specific measures to suppress porosity, and control the welding penetration so that the weld quality meets the standard requirements and the defect rate is controlled to a minimum.
